Subject: Crash pipeline ownership change

Heads up for on-call: ownership of the Fallcatcher crash-report pipeline for the Brightfern mobile app is moving off the platform team effective next sprint. Triage thresholds and symbolication alerts stay unchanged, but escalation paths in the runbook will be updated this week. Until then, route any pipeline stalls or symbol upload failures to the new owner, named below.

account owner for bawip-tahag: Raleth Quenok

Runbook: Tidepool Widget Refresh

Widget pulls tide tables from the Saltgrave feed every 20 minutes. If the embed shows stale data: check the fetcher pod logs, confirm the feed endpoint responds, then restart the fetcher. Cache TTL is 25 minutes; don't shorten it without review. Fallback renders last-known table with a staleness banner — verify that path before approving changes. Fetcher reads config from its env file, which must include the feed access key on one line.

vault entry, kagep-yajeg: COURIER_KEY5=da097

Welcome to the Quillspool plugin program. Quillspool is the printer-spooler microservice behind Fennwick Systems' print pipeline, and external plugins interact with it through the job-intake queue rather than the spool daemon directly. Before registering your plugin, confirm your sandbox tenant has been provisioned by the Quillspool team and that queue polling is enabled. Plugins persist job metadata to the shared staging database. Connect to it using the following string.

primary connection of tawif-yajeg = postgresql://rusiel_svc:G879q9cx6GsSvj@db-dd9f.norvagrid.internal:5432/casath

## Changelog — wavelink-gateway v4.2.1

Changed defaults to address the websocket reconnect bug reported after the v4.2.0 rollout. Previously, clients reconnected with no jitter and a fixed two-second backoff, causing synchronized reconnect storms whenever a gateway node cycled. The new defaults add full jitter, a longer backoff ceiling, and a capped retry budget per session. No API changes; existing overrides are preserved. Release manager should confirm these land in the prod config bundle. The updated default values are listed below.

config for bagep-kageg:
ULADOR_LOG_LEVEL=warn
ULADOR_METRICS_HOST=metrics.ulador.tolvaqcorp.corp
ULADOR_POOL_SIZE=32